Overview

Miguel Couttolenc is a corporate attorney in Holland & Knight's Mexico City office. Mr. Couttolenc focuses his practice primarily on mergers and acquisitions (M&A) and project finance.

Mr. Couttolenc advises companies and banking institutions in structured financing transactions with complex collateral schemes. He also advises domestic and foreign sellers, buyers and investors in local and cross-border M&A transactions, as well as in the implementation of strategic alliances.

In addition, Mr. Couttolenc has knowledge and experience in joint ventures, corporate governance and general corporate law.

Prior to joining Holland & Knight, Mr. Couttolenc worked for a full-service Mexican law firm.

Representative Experience

  • Advised a lending company to carry out a structured financing to a leading Mexican real estate company for the acquisition and administration of industrial warehouses in the Bajío area and northern Mexico
  • Advised a lending company to carry out a structured financing to a leading Mexican real estate company to refinance its debt and expand its administration of shopping malls and corporate office buildings in Mexico City
  • Advised a Mexican banking institution to carry out a structured financing to the government of Hidalgo to enable it to deploy a bus transportation system for the city of Pachuca de Soto and its metropolitan area
  • Advised a foreign telecommunications company in the structuring of a loan to a leading Mexican telecommunications company for the deployment of a major fiber optic network
  • Advised a leading telecommunications company in Mexico in its restructuring and merger with another leading telecommunications company in Mexico and the United States, in a deal worth more than $4 billion
  • Advised a foreign investment fund in a funding round to acquire a stake in a Mexican technology start-up, which subsequently and consequently acquired the status of a "unicorn" company
  • Advised on the delisting of the publicly traded shares of one of Mexico's leading energy companies
